最新版本的Breeze支持EF6。要使用EF7迁移一个Breeze项目需要什么?
由于我的项目目前使用的是EFContextProvider,我认为我必须回过头来,转而依赖DbContext。这是否意味着我必须为EFContextProvider实现一个替换来使用最新版本,还是有一种方法可以让当前的EFContextProvider版本使用EF7的DbContext?
发布于 2015-02-19 17:14:37
EF7是对实体框架的重写。这意味着有许多,许多重大的变化。没有现有的EF6组件将与EF7一起工作。甚至DbContext的命名空间也发生了变化。要阅读更多关于决定将其命名为EF7而不是给它一个新名称的信息,请阅读EF7 - v1还是v7?
发布于 2016-01-13 16:16:20
拥有Breeze的沃德·贝尔( Ward Bell )在2015年10月告诉我,他们已经开始研究EF 7,并了解需要从哪里获取元数据才能在Breeze完成所需的代码管道,但他们并没有指望在2015年年底之前开始研究。他说,他们完全打算支持ASP.NET 5和EF 7,它们都处于发布候选状态,预计将发布Q1。如果一个月内出现了支持EF 7的Breeze测试版,我不会感到惊讶。
此外,贝尔在DevSum2015做了一次会议,他在会上谈到了在这段时间里弥合了布雷兹和EF 7之间的差距。他有一些手写元数据的例子,以及对他的幻灯片的PDF摘要的展望。
https://stackoverflow.com/questions/28595875
复制相似问题